Hesham Sakr - 21 Jul 2007 01:56 GMT
Why does Access 2007 all of a sudden shrinks the database file  size
specially when migrated form and older version??

moreover, when access stops responding, it created another file named
filename+backup which is the same but smaller in size????
can any one help?

If I remember right, Access builds a new database, which is empty, and
then imports all the objects, so you end up with a compacted
database.  What happens if you compact the database first and then
convert?  Are the sizes similar?  Basically, Access doesn't actually
purge records marked as deleted until you compact the database...
